About This Access Site
**Location & Facilities**
Archangel Access is a concrete boat ramp located about one mile east of Livonia in Schuyler County, providing access to the Chariton River via Highway 136. The site is situated at a Missouri Department of Conservation area north of town and serves as a convenient launch point for paddlers and motorboaters.

**Paddling Opportunities**
This access point is popular for float trips on the Chariton River. A notable trip runs approximately 10 miles from Rebel's Cove to Archangel Access—manageable in a day for most paddlers. Those with a single vehicle can walk back roughly one mile from the lower boat ramp to the launch point to avoid the need for two-vehicle shuttles. The area also supports hunting and fishing activities, making it a multi-use recreation site.
